Lot Description:A Chinese Pair of Bronze Ritual Vessels, Gu, Late Shang Dynasty, 13th/12th Century BC
the narrow wine-breakers of exquisite craftsmanship, with flared neck, finely detailed with bands of varying patterns forming different parts of dragons and 'daodie' masks, lovely patina and some green encrustation, 28.6 and 28.8cm high -
References:See Robert Bagley Shang Ritual Bronzes in the Arthur M. Sackler Collections, Vol. 1 Washington D.C. 1987, pp217-229.
